打造跨屏幕的完美体验
在当今数字化时代,网站和应用程序的设计变得至关重要,随着移动设备的普及,用户倾向于使用各种尺寸的设备来浏览信息,响应式设计成为了一个不可或缺的需求,确保无论用户使用的是桌面电脑、平板电脑还是智能手机,都能获得一致和高质量的用户体验,本文将深入探讨响应式设计的各个方面,包括其重要性、实现方法以及面临的挑战。
响应式设计的重要性不言而喻,随着网络技术的发展,人们可以随时随地访问互联网,这意味着用户期望他们的设备能够无缝地显示不同的内容和功能,响应式设计正是为了满足这一需求而生,它通过使用媒体查询和其他技术手段,使得网页在不同大小的屏幕上都能保持良好的布局和功能,这不仅提高了用户体验,还有助于提高搜索引擎优化(SEO)效果,因为搜索引擎蜘蛛更容易抓取和索引响应式网站。
实现响应式设计的方法有很多,但最基本的原则是使用弹性网格系统,这种系统允许设计师根据不同屏幕尺寸调整元素的大小和位置,从而确保内容在任何设备上都能正确显示,CSS3的媒体查询功能也是实现响应式设计的关键工具,通过编写特定的CSS规则,可以针对不同的屏幕分辨率和方向设置样式,从而实现自适应布局。
响应式设计并非没有挑战,设计师需要对不同设备的屏幕尺寸有深入的了解,这样才能准确地应用媒体查询,由于不同设备之间的性能差异,一些老旧的或者配置较低的设备可能无法流畅地展示响应式设计的网站或应用,随着技术的不断进步,新的屏幕尺寸和设备类型也在不断出现,这要求设计师必须持续学习和更新知识,以保持设计的时效性和相关性。
为了克服这些挑战,设计师可以采取多种策略,他们可以使用渐进增强(Progressive Enhancement)的方法,先为主流设备提供基础的样式和功能,然后逐步添加更多的特性,以便更好地适应各种设备,利用现代的前端框架和库,如Bootstrap或Tailwind CSS,可以帮助设计师更轻松地实现响应式设计,这些框架提供了许多预先定义的组件和类,使设计师能够快速构建出美观且功能丰富的响应式网站。
除了技术和工具之外,用户体验(UX)也是响应式设计中不可忽视的因素,设计师需要关注用户的行为模式和偏好,以确保无论用户使用哪种设备,都能获得良好的交互体验,这可能意味着需要重新设计某些界面元素,或者调整导航结构,以适应不同设备上的可用性。
响应式设计不仅仅是关于视觉上的适配,它还涉及到内容的布局和排版,设计师需要确保在不同设备上,文字、图片和其他媒体内容都能够清晰可见,并且与页面的整体风格保持一致,这可能需要对内容进行微调,或者使用CSS的Flexbox和Grid系统等技术来优化布局。
响应式设计是一项复杂而重要的工作,它要求设计师具备高度的创造力和技术能力,以确保无论用户使用何种设备,都能获得一致和优质的体验,随着技术的不断发展,我们有理由相信,响应式设计将继续引领网页设计和开发的未来。
还没有评论,来说两句吧...